Albrecht Viktor Haller (since 1749 Albrecht von Haller, also Albert de Haller, born 16 October 1708 in Bern, died 12 December 1777 there) was a Swiss physician and polymath, especially a natural scientist, who is considered, among other things, the founder of modern experimental physiology.
